Job description

Employer Industry: Crisis Intervention Services

Why consider this job opportunity:

  • Salary up to $16.50 per hour
  • Extensive benefits package including medical insurance with up to 80% premium coverage
  • 401k with a company contribution after one year of employment
  • Generous paid time off starting at 5 weeks in the first year
  • Flexibility to work from home part or full-time
  • Opportunities for flexible schedules in a 24/7 operation
What to Expect (Job Responsibilities)
  • Answer inbound calls for the 988 Suicide & Crisis Lifeline and 211 information and referral contacts
  • Assess contact's needs using active listening and pertinent questions
  • Provide appropriate screenings for specialized programs and refer contacts to resources
  • Maintain accurate data collection on all contacts in the database
  • Adhere to confidentiality standards and complete training for new programs related to 211 and Crisis Services
What is Required (Qualifications)
  • High School diploma or equivalent required
  • One year of experience in social services, crisis hotline, contact center, or information and referral service preferred
  • Experience with Microsoft Office required
  • Ability to effectively assess client needs and show sensitivity to issues presented by contacts
  • Must have access to a private, secure, and stable high-speed internet connection
How to Stand Out (Preferred Qualifications)
  • Experience with client management databases or other relational databases
  • Bilingual in English/Spanish
